diff options
| author | Neil <nyamatongwe@gmail.com> | 2020-07-16 10:20:23 +1000 |
|---|---|---|
| committer | Neil <nyamatongwe@gmail.com> | 2020-07-16 10:20:23 +1000 |
| commit | 335f4af10b617f51eb64ed4b15267e13cf587afa (patch) | |
| tree | 129ae76bab5d9f489bc9dda56360315f1b60cb61 /src/Editor.cxx | |
| parent | 97782cf42d51d2834a9a92f460a1cb7d483f09d7 (diff) | |
| download | scintilla-mirror-335f4af10b617f51eb64ed4b15267e13cf587afa.tar.gz | |
Backport: Make WrapMode an enum class for more type safety.
Backport of changeset 8413:ef7672c46486.
Diffstat (limited to 'src/Editor.cxx')
| -rw-r--r-- | src/Editor.cxx |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/Editor.cxx b/src/Editor.cxx index 35bcec9d7..962f62cf1 100644 --- a/src/Editor.cxx +++ b/src/Editor.cxx @@ -1467,7 +1467,7 @@ void Editor::UpdateSystemCaret() { } bool Editor::Wrapping() const noexcept { - return vs.wrapState != eWrapNone; + return vs.wrapState != WrapMode::none; } void Editor::NeedWrapping(Sci::Line docLineStart, Sci::Line docLineEnd) { @@ -6373,11 +6373,11 @@ sptr_t Editor::WndProc(unsigned int iMessage, uptr_t wParam, sptr_t lParam) { return view.printParameters.colourMode; case SCI_SETPRINTWRAPMODE: - view.printParameters.wrapState = (wParam == SC_WRAP_WORD) ? eWrapWord : eWrapNone; + view.printParameters.wrapState = (wParam == SC_WRAP_WORD) ? WrapMode::word : WrapMode::none; break; case SCI_GETPRINTWRAPMODE: - return view.printParameters.wrapState; + return static_cast<sptr_t>(view.printParameters.wrapState); case SCI_GETSTYLEAT: if (static_cast<Sci::Position>(wParam) >= pdoc->Length()) @@ -6679,7 +6679,7 @@ sptr_t Editor::WndProc(unsigned int iMessage, uptr_t wParam, sptr_t lParam) { break; case SCI_GETWRAPMODE: - return vs.wrapState; + return static_cast<sptr_t>(vs.wrapState); case SCI_SETWRAPVISUALFLAGS: if (vs.SetWrapVisualFlags(static_cast<int>(wParam))) { |
